    The geographical location of the Republic of Cyprus, as the European Union member closest to the Middle East, provides the capability of early warning and preparation of the appropriate authorities in Cyprus and the EU, to manage the migration flow originating from countries of crisis in the Middle East, and intercept illegal trafficking of third country citizens onboard vessels towards Cyprus and/or other European countries.

    JRCC Larnaca in cooperation with all involved Departments of the Ministry of Transport, Communication and Works and the Ministry of Interiors, submitted a proposal to the Ministerial Council, for the development of a multipurpose Coordination Centre, able to manage a complete surveillance, location, identification, prevention, command and control system, covering the maritime area of responsibility and jurisdiction of the Republic of Cyprus in Eastern Mediterranean, serving, also, as a Coordination Centre for Humanitarian Operations due to natural or other disasters.

    The “Zenon” Coordination Centre has the potentials to significantly contribute to the management and efficient confrontation of National Crisis, as foreseen by the Basic National Plan “ZENON”, in which possible crisis situations have been identified, falling under the jurisdiction of the Ministries. Apart from the fixed installed systems, additional mobile surveillance and identification systems, such as the long range thermal imaging and the unmanned aerial vehicles, are standing-by to be deployed and contribute, whenever requested by the competent Ministry.
